I used to get sick every time I ate here, but my husband noticed they had changed location and decided to pop in. They explained that they had moved location for this very reason. They now have a bigger kitchen so they can have a dedicated GF section. He bought me a couple things and I nervously gave them a try. I didn't get sick! Woohoo! The pie crust is meh, but hey, it's pie. I'm not picky. ;) The eclairs and cream puffs are stand outs. That plus the wide variety of bakery yummies make this place worth checking out.

I've been a gluten free customer of white box pies for the last four years. Their menu offers regular and gluten-free lunch and awesome desserts!! I love their GF Turkey cranberry sandwich and their GF turkey Reuben!! In reading the other reviews the one person who gave WBP a one star must be an idiot. Who uses two pans for everything to avoid cross-contamination? How cost affective is that for any restaurant or at home?! I have asked the same question about cross-contamination and their equipment, and anybody can use the same equipment and pans as long as you wash them in between every use. I have watched white box pies staff and they use separate equipment for making immediate sandwiches , and for dessert...they make sure that they're doing gluten-free at one time and regular items separately after they've washed their equipment in between uses. I have talked with the white box pie staff and they take the best precaution possible to avoid cross-contamination. We love white box pies!!! White Box pies is not advised for Celiacs. They do not understand about cross contamination. Both times I questioned the chef was told they use the same pans for everything. If gluten free is an option for you they have good food. If you are sensitive and it is medically important this is not the place.
